Georgia School for the Deaf Historic District is a park in Georgia, at a recorded 201 m. Flagpole Mountain stands 598 m to the southwest, 7.5 miles off. The nearest named place is Rolater Park, a park 0.2 miles away. Appalachian Highlands Scenic Byway passes 16 miles off.

Months averaging 50–80 °F: Mar–Jun, Aug–Nov.
| Jan | Feb | Mar | Apr | May | Jun | Jul | Aug | Sep | Oct | Nov | Dec | |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| Avg °F | 43 | 46 | 54 | 62 | 70 | 77 | 81 | 80 | 74 | 63 | 52 | 45 |
| Precip in | 4.9 | 5.1 | 5.3 | 4.4 | 4.0 | 3.9 | 4.9 | 3.5 | 3.7 | 3.6 | 4.4 | 5.0 |
1991–2020 U.S. Climate Normals, NOAA NCEI — Cedartown, 7 mi away.
